Mary Lois Vroon, age 89, of Grand Rapids, passed away on Friday, February 3, 2023. She was born on May 2, 1933, in Grand Rapids, to Jay & Janette (Spoelstra) Boerema.
She married the love of her life, John W. Vroon on September 14, 1963. After one week of amazing dates, John asked her to marry him. Their love and devotion lasted their entire lives! He preceded her in death on September 6, 2021.
Mary attended Calvin University. She obtained her Master's Degree from the University of Michigan. She worked as an elementary teacher and later tutored dyslexic children and adults.
